Justin Mclean updated FLEX-18827: --------------------------------- Labels: easytest (was: ) > Setting fork attribute to true causes ant build to fail. > -------------------------------------------------------- > > Key: FLEX-18827 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/FLEX-18827 > Project: Apache Flex > Issue Type: Bug > Components: Ant Tasks > Affects Versions: Adobe Flex SDK Previous > Environment: Affected OS(s): All OS Platforms > Affected OS(s): All OS Platforms > Language Found: English > Reporter: Adobe JIRA > Labels: easytest > > THIS IS A DRIVE LETTER ISSUE > Steps to reproduce: > 1. Install Eclipse and Flex builder to your C:\ drive > 2. Set up your workspace to be on your D:\ drive > 3. Create a new project > 4. Set the frok="true" in your mxmlc tag > 5. Build the project > > Actual Results: > Project fails to build with error > [echo] 3.2.0.3958 > [mxmlc] java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: flex2/tools/Compiler > [mxmlc] Exception in thread "main" > Expected Results: > Project should build. > remove the fork and the project builds. However if you have a large > application and you need the fork to be true so that the memory management > will work, you are SOL. > > Workaround (if any): > > NO WORK AROUND FOR LARGE PROJECTS THAT REQUIRE MORE MEMORY TO BUILD. -- This message is automatically generated by JIRA.
